C-P
Conservation Preservation District
The CP district is established to preserve and control development within certain land, marsh and water areas of this county. These areas serve as wildlife refuges, possess great natural beauty, are of historical or ecological significance, are utilized for outdoor recreational purposes or provide needed open space for the health and general welfare of the county's inhabitants. The regulations are designed to discourage encroachment of uses capable of destroying the undeveloped character of the CP district.
